# -*- coding: utf-8 -*-
"""
@author: ufriess
Adapted Robert Schmidt Jan/Feb 2022
This script is intended to add scans that were marked in paper.
They do not need to be sorted by problem.
The file names should contain a?? for the problem number at the start.
The files are QR-scanned and then added to the already existing
data base 'klausur_map'. (name defined below)
Required packages:
pytzbar - pip install pyzbar
fitz - pip install PyMuPDF
PIL - pip install pillow
pdf2image - pip install pdf2image
"""
import pandas as pd
import os
import io
from pyzbar import pyzbar
from pyzbar.pyzbar import ZBarSymbol
import fitz
from PIL import Image
import glob
import warnings
def get_images_from_PDF_page(doc, page):
result = []
for i, img in enumerate(doc.getPageImageList(page)):
xref = img[0]
pix = fitz.Pixmap(doc, xref)
if pix.n < 5: # this is GRAY or RGB
d = pix.getPNGdata()
else: # CMYK: convert to RGB first
pix1 = fitz.Pixmap(fitz.csRGB, pix)
d = pix1.getPNGdata()
fimg = io.BytesIO()
fimg.write(d)
fimg.seek(0)
result = result + [Image.open(fimg)]
# os.remove('tmp.png')
return result
def create_Klausur_map():
return pd.DataFrame(index = pd.MultiIndex(levels=[[],[],[]],
codes=[[],[],[]],
names=['num', 'Aufgabe', 'Seite']),
columns = ['PDFSeite', 'Filename', 'Rotation'])
def add_Klausur_map(klausur_map, num, Aufgabe, Seite, PDFSeite, Filename,
Rotation = 0,
verbose = False,
verify_integrity = True, inplace = True):
if inplace:
result = klausur_map
else:
result = klausur_map.copy()
assert all([e >= 0 for e in [num, Aufgabe, Seite, PDFSeite]])
result.loc[num, Aufgabe, Seite] = {
'PDFSeite': PDFSeite,
'Filename': os.path.basename(Filename),
'Rotation': Rotation
}
if verbose:
print(result.loc[num, Aufgabe, Seite])
if not inplace:
return result
def add_Klausur_map_aufgabe(klausur_map, num, Aufgabe, Seite, PDFSeite,
Filename,
Rotation = 0,
verbose = False,
verify_integrity = True, inplace = True):
if inplace:
result = klausur_map
else:
result = klausur_map.copy()
assert all([e >= 0 for e in [num, Aufgabe, Seite, PDFSeite]])
result.loc[num, Aufgabe, Seite] = {
'PDFSeite': PDFSeite,
'Filename': os.path.basename(Filename),
'Rotation': Rotation,
'PDFSeite_aufgabe': PDFSeite,
'Filename_aufgabe': os.path.basename(Filename),
}
if verbose:
print(result.loc[num, Aufgabe, Seite])
if not inplace:
return result
def scan_Klausur_QR_map(filename, verbose = False):
global images
print ('start scan_Klausur_QR_map')
klausur_map = create_Klausur_map()
failed = pd.DataFrame(columns = ['PDFSeite', 'Filename'])
files = glob.glob(filename)
for f in files:
fname = os.path.basename(f)
aufgabe = int(fname[1:3]) # extract Aufgabe from file name
print('Scanning QR codes in', fname)
doc = fitz.open(f)
# 1. this assumes that front and reverse sides are scanned
# and put next to each other in pdf (even number of pages!)
# 2. it is also assumed that there is only a bar code on the
# front side
# 3. the script will determine where the qr code is and
# treat the other side as reverse
for page in range(0,len(doc)-1,2):
n_err = 0
error = True
while error:
try:
images1 = get_images_from_PDF_page(doc, page)
images2 = get_images_from_PDF_page(doc, page+1)
error = False
except:
n_err += 1
if n_err > 3:
raise
qr1 = []
qr2 = []
for image in images1:
code = pyzbar.decode(image.convert(mode = '1', dither = 0), symbols=[ZBarSymbol.QRCODE])
qr1 = qr1 + code
for image in images2:
code = pyzbar.decode(image.convert(mode = '1', dither = 0), symbols=[ZBarSymbol.QRCODE])
qr2 = qr2 + code
l1=len(qr1)
l2=len(qr2)
p1=0
p2=0
if (l1 == 1) or (l2 ==1):
if l1==1:
data = qr1[0].data.decode("utf-8")
rotation = 0 if qr1[0].rect.top < 800 else 180
info = data.split(',')
p1=0+int(info[2]) # first scan is first page
p2=1+int(info[2]) # first scan is first page
elif l2==1:
data = qr2[0].data.decode("utf-8")
rotation = 0 if qr2[0].rect.top < 800 else 180
info = data.split(',')
p1=1+int(info[2]) # second scan is first page
p2=0+int(info[2]) # second scan is first page
else:
print ('problem, no front page found')
# good diagnostic in output (-> pipe to output file)
print (info,p1,p2)
add_Klausur_map(klausur_map,
int(info[0]), # Nummer
int(aufgabe), # Aufgabe
int(p1), # Vorder/Rückseite
page + 1, # PDF Seite
fname, # Filename
Rotation = rotation,
inplace = True
)
add_Klausur_map(klausur_map,
int(info[0]), # Nummer
int(aufgabe), # Aufgabe
int(p2), # Vorder/Rückseite
page + 2, # PDF Seite
fname, # Filename
Rotation = rotation,
inplace = True
)
if verbose:
print(page, info)
else:
failed = failed.append({'PDFSeite': page + 1, 'Filename': fname}, ignore_index = True)
if l1 == 0 and l2 == 0:
print('No QR code found on page',page + 1)
else:
print('Multiple QR codes found on page',page + 1)
# for img in images:
# img.close()
doc.close()
return klausur_map.drop_duplicates().sort_index(), failed
def add_scans_to_klausur_map(klausur_map, add_map):
for index, sequence in add_map.iterrows():
# this will cause wrong entries if index-tuple exists already!
add_Klausur_map_aufgabe(klausur_map,
int(index[0]),
index[1],
index[2],
sequence.PDFSeite,
sequence.Filename,
Rotation = sequence.Rotation,
inplace = True
)
# done in place, no need to return copy
#return klausur_map
######### Main Program
warnings.filterwarnings("ignore")
# Pfad zu den gescannten Klausuren
path_scanned = 'add_scans'
klausur_map = pd.read_pickle('map_orig.pkl')
#klausur_map_add = pd.read_pickle('add.pkl')
#%% Sammle Informationen von QR-Codes in Klausuren
#print('Scanning QR codes')
klausur_map_add, failed = scan_Klausur_QR_map(path_scanned + '/*.pdf', verbose = False)
# adding scanned pages to klausur_map data base
add_scans_to_klausur_map(klausur_map, klausur_map_add)
print('writing to data base')
# create also an xls version for easy checking with libreoffice
klausur_map.to_pickle('new.pkl')
klausur_map.to_excel('new.xls')
# easier access for manual checking with xls file
#failed.to_pickle('klausur_qr_scan_failed.pkl')
failed.to_excel('klausur_qr_scan_failed.xls')
